Intraday Price Action and Outperformance Context
Sindhu Trade Links Ltd recorded a notable intraday surge of 7.04% on 4 Sep 2026, touching a high of Rs 25.82. This single-session gain stands out sharply against the sector’s more modest advance and the Sensex’s 0.72% rise. The stock’s outperformance is further underscored by its 6.00% gain relative to the Sensex on the day, signalling a strong buying interest focused on this small-cap Diversified company. The session’s momentum was sustained throughout, with the stock closing near its peak, suggesting conviction behind the move rather than a fleeting spike. Recent Performance Trajectory
Leading into this session, Sindhu Trade Links Ltd had been on a modest upward trajectory, gaining 1.92% over the past week and 4.22% in the last month, while the Sensex declined by 0.73% and 2.20% respectively during those periods. This recent positive momentum contrasts with a 3-month performance of -2.57%, indicating a recovery phase after a short-term setback. Year-to-date, the stock has surged 28.67%, vastly outperforming the Sensex’s -10.00%, reflecting a strong underlying trend despite some volatility. The 7.04% intraday gain on 4 Sep 2026 thus partially extends this recovery, building on a two-day consecutive gain that has delivered a 6.85% return. The 3-year performance remains negative at -13.49%, suggesting that while the stock has shown resilience recently, longer-term challenges persist. Moving Average Configuration
The technical backdrop for Sindhu Trade Links Ltd is notably constructive. The stock is trading above all its key moving averages — the 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day — a configuration that typically signals strength and a bullish technical posture. This broad-based support from short-, medium-, and long-term averages suggests the surge is not merely a relief rally but part of a sustained momentum phase. The 50 DMA, often a critical resistance level, has been decisively surpassed, removing a key overhead barrier. Such a setup often precedes further upside or at least consolidation at higher levels rather than a quick reversal. The alignment of these averages contrasts with the broader market, where the Sensex trades below its 50 DMA, indicating that Sindhu Trade Links Ltd is moving from a position of relative strength within a mixed market environment.

Technical Indicators
The technical indicator readings for Sindhu Trade Links Ltd present a nuanced picture. On the weekly timeframe, the MACD and KST oscillators are mildly bearish, while the Bollinger Bands also signal bearishness, suggesting some short-term caution. Conversely, monthly indicators such as MACD and KST lean bullish, and the monthly Bollinger Bands are mildly positive, indicating longer-term momentum remains intact. The daily moving averages are mildly bullish, reinforcing the positive price action seen in recent sessions. The Dow Theory readings are mixed, mildly bullish weekly but mildly bearish monthly, reflecting the tension between short- and long-term trends. The On-Balance Volume (OBV) is mildly bearish on both weekly and monthly charts, hinting at some underlying volume weakness despite price gains. Market Context
The broader market environment on 4 Sep 2026 was positive, with the Sensex opening 504.16 points higher and trading at 76,701.08, a 0.72% gain. Mega-cap stocks led the advance, while the Sensex remained below its 50 DMA, indicating some underlying market caution. Within this context, Sindhu Trade Links Ltd’s outperformance is particularly notable given its small-cap status and sector placement in Diversified industries. The stock’s 7.04% gain and leadership within its sector suggest a stock-specific catalyst or renewed investor focus, rather than a mere reflection of broad market strength.
